Synthesis and Properties of a Novel Symmetrical Diarylethene with Bromine Atoms

Abstract:

A new symmetrical photochromic diarylethene which is called 1,2-bis (2, 5-dimethyl-4-dromine-3-thienyl) perfluorocyclopentene (1o) was synthesized, and its photochromic reactivity, fluorescent were also investigated. The results showed that it exhibited excellent photochromism, changing from colorless to pink after irradiation with UV light in solution. When the concentration arrived at 2 × 10-5 mol·L-1, the fluorescence intensity of the diarylethene reached the maximum. Furthermore, the fluorescence intensity of the photochromic diarylethene 1o declined remarkably, when irradiation with UV light. Using this diarylethene 1o as optical storage and fluorescence switches was performed successfully.
